Description
PE Tarpaulin. Consisting of a woven high density (HDPE) polyethylene yarn inner, laminated with a low-density polyethylene (LDPE) coating. Individually packaged in a polybag with colour branded insert. Intended use is to protect objects temporarily against rain, dust etc. Features a welded hem containing polypropylene rope around all edges. Aluminium eyelets are placed at one-meter intervals. Colour: Black Weight: 235 grams per square metre Size: 2 metres x 3 metres

Justification
Classification has been determined in accordance with the following: General Interpretative Rules (GIR)’s: For the purposes of determining the commodity codes within which goods most appropriately fall, reg 3 (1) of The Customs Tariff (Establishment) (EU Exit) Regulations 2020 sets out that the rules of interpretation contained in the following have effect – a. Part Two (Goods Classification Table Rules of Interpretation) of the Tariff of the United Kingdom (Reg 3(1)(a)); and b. Notes to a section or chapter of the Goods Classification Table (Reg 3(1)(b)). GIR 1 has been used to classify this product by the terms of heading 3926 - other articles of plastics and articles of other materials of headings 3901 to 3914. GIR 5(b) has been used to identify packaging – a polybag with colour branded insert GIR 6 has been used to classify the goods to subheading level 392690 - other than statuettes and other ornamental articles 8 Digit Code: 39269097 - other than perforated buckets and similar articles used to filter water at the entrance to drains; other than protective face shields/visors. 10 Digit Code: 3926909790 - other than elsewhere specified or included. Also classified in accordance with: Chapter 39: note 1 refers. HESNS to 3920 HSEN's to heading 3926
